An organic compound (A) of molecular formula C3H6 on reaction with Conc. H2SO4 and H2O gives ClH5O as (B) as a MarkownikoWs product. (B) on oxidation with Cu at 573 K gives (C) of formula C3H6O. (C) on reaction with CH3MgBr followed by acid hydrolysis yields (D) as C4H10O which will not give any colour in Victor Meyer’s test. Identify A, B, C, D and explain the reactions involved.

1. An organic compound (A) is identified from the molecular formula as CH3 – CH = CH2 propene.

2. Propene on hydrolysis in acid medium, Markownikoff’s rule is followed and the product formed is

3. Propan – 2 – ol on reaction with Cu at 573 K undergoes dehydrogenation reaction to produce Propanone as (C).

4. Propanone on reaction with CH3MgBr followed by acid hydrolysis gives tertiary butyl alcohol (D). It will not give any colouration in Victor Meyer’s test.
